When visiting Japan, you expect to come in contact with some of the coolest things in the world. Cutting edge technology,  ahead of the curve fashions and awesome vending machines that house anything and everything, are just a few of the wonders visitors encounter. Capsule hotels are another. These unique lodging options are just a little bigger than a coffin, cost around $30 a night to stay and include all the conveniences one could ever need. 9 h (nainawasu) is a new capsule hotel that offers luxury in a minimum living space. Designed by Fumie Shibata of design studio s, the hotel is 9 stories tall, hosts 125 capsules, locker rooms, showers and a lounge. The 9h Capsule Hotel is named that because you’re only supposed to stay there for nine hours. Props to you if you can handle more than one.
